Road closed as armed police called to property in Gorseinon, Swansea

A road in Swansea was closed in both directions as armed police were called to on a residential area in Gorseinon .

Officers from South Wales Police were called to Gower View Road on Sunday afternoon after concerns were raised for the welfare of a resident.

The road was closed from Brynafon Road to Llannant Road.

A 41-year-old was subsequently detained under the Mental Health Act.

Gower View Road was closed on Sunday afternoon (Jonathan Myers)

A spokeswoman for South Wales Police said: "Police were called to a property on Gower View Road, Gorseinon, at approximately 1.25pm today (Sunday, January 12) after concerns were raised for the welfare of a resident.

"Armed officers were deployed alongside divisional units as a precautionary measure, and the road was closed for a short time while the incident was safely resolved.

"The road has since reopened and local residents are thanked for their patience and understanding."
